How eco-smart drive car insurance usa Pay-Per-Mile Insurance Works?

EcoSmart Drive’s pay-per-mile model charges a low flat base premium each month plus a fee for every mile driven.n For example, if the base is $60/month and the per-mile rate is $0.10, driving 1,200 miles costs $180, whereas driving just 400 miles that month would cost only $1.00. This flexibility ensures you don’t overpay for unused coverage.

eco-smart drive car insurance usa  All major traditional coverage options (liability, collision, comprehensive) remain intact – only the pricing method changes.

  • Base Premium + Per-Mile Rate: Your insurer sets a base fee (based on factors like age, location, vehicle) and then a per-mile rate (often $0.02–$0.10/mile).

  • Telematics Tracking: A small plug-in OBD-II device or a mobile app records your miles driven. Some insurers also allow uploading odometer photos for a low-tech option.

  • Daily Mileage Caps: To prevent bill shock on road trips, many plans cap daily mileage (e.g., 250 miles per day). Any miles beyond this cap in one day won’t be charged.

  • Discounts for Safe Driving: In addition to mileage, EcoSmart Drive may use telematics to identify safe habits (smooth braking, limited night driving) and apply extra discounts, much like standard usage-based plans.

Because billing is based on real data, your monthly premium adjusts with your driving: if you drive less one month, you save more Industry experts note that pay-per-mile insurance is ideal for low-mileage drivers and those looking to align their insurance costs with actual use. In fact, MoneyGeek reports that UBI (Usage-Based Insurance) plans like this are cost-effective for anyone under roughly 10,000 annual miles.

Electric Vehicle Coverage and Green Benefits?

As an eco-smart program, EcoSmart Drive is well-suited for electric and hybrid vehicles. These cars typically drive fewer miles and have different risk profiles. However, insurers note EV premiums are generally higher due to expensive parts and tech: Insurify data finds average EV insurance is 49% higher than for gas cars. For example, EVs cost ~$4,058/year to insure vs. $2,732 for traditional cars. Factors include higher replacement costs and specialized repairs. eco-smart drive car insurance usa

EcoSmart Drive can offset these costs by adjusting per-mile rates for EV owners. Some insurers already offer green discounts (e.g., Travelers, Lemonade have EV/hybrid savings. EcoSmart may bundle incentives for low-carbon drivers, such as lower rates for using a vehicle on electric power or for driving mostly in eco-friendly modes. Over time, as EV repair networks grow, premiums should moderate.

eco-smart drive car insurance usa In the meantime, the pay-per-mile structure naturally benefits EV drivers, who often log fewer miles (urban commuters, etc.) and so pay significantly less than with a flat rate policy.

Key EV Insurance Stats: The National Association of Insurance Commissioners notes EV coverage can run up to $44/month higher than gas vehicles, yet EV owners save on maintenance and fuel, partly offsetting this. Popular models like Tesla also offer in-house insurance that uses telematics-based Safety Scores,” rating drivers on real behavior rather than demographics. FAQs

Q: What is pay-per-mile (usage-based) car insurance?
A: Pay-per-mile insurance (also called Usage-Based Insurance, UBI) is a type of auto coverage where your premium includes a fixed base charge plus a fee for each mile you drive. You typically install a telematics device or use an app that tracks your mileage. EcoSmart Drive uses this model, so safe, low-mileage drivers pay less than they would under a traditional policy.

Q: Are there limits on how much I can drive?
A: Typically, no strict limits. However, many plans (including EcoSmart Drive) cap daily miles at a threshold (often 250 miles/day). If you exceed this cap in one day, additional miles beyond it are not charged. This protects you from unexpectedly high bills during occasional long trips. Overall, you have flexibility in how much you drive; paying-per-mile simply aligns cost with usage. eco-smart drive car insurance usa
